Expert Witnesses

The right train and railroad accident lawyer can help you make a convincing case with experts to prove your case. Experts might be engineering or medical professionals that can provide information regarding your specific injury. They can also help you understand how your injuries will impact your future. A neurologist, for instance, could help your lawyer identify the signs of a brain injury so that the jury can better comprehend and be aware of how it could affect you in the future.

Your attorney will typically hire the experts based on their expertise in the field of your injury. They then conduct a thorough research and review their credentials based on and education, professional affiliations, performance, and so on. Once they have a list of potential expert witness candidates they will interview each and choose the best ones to assist you.

These experts can help the jury and court to understand the causes of an accident and who was responsible. They can explain how various factors such as road conditions, weather, and equipment failures may be a factor in the accident. They can also assist the court understand how those elements could have been avoided.

Other kinds of expert witnesses your attorney may call upon include:

Accident reconstruction experts can examine evidence at a crash scene and recreate the incident to show how it unfolded. Engineers can testify regarding the design of a structure or vehicle to determine if it is safe. Actuaries and financial experts can testify about the economic impact of an accident by calculating lost wages and financial implications for the future.
